Since the installation of a dense cabled observation network around the Japan Trench (S-net) by the Japanese government that includes 150 sensors, several tsunami forecasting methods that use the data collected from the ocean floor sensors were developed. One of such methods is the tsunami forecasting method which assimilates the data without any information of earthquakes.
